Narrative:
THE WRECKAGE WAS LOCATED AT THE 3,030 FOOT ELEVATION ON THE SOUTH SIDE OF A PLATEAU. THE WEATHER IN THE AREA OF THE ACCIDENT WOULD HAVE APPROXIMATED THE REPORTED CONDITIONS AT PRESCOTT, AZ LOCATED APPROXIMATELY 40 MI NNW. CAUSE:
